Capacitance tolerance is another important aspect of capacitor performance. The Polypropylene Film Capacitor offers a capacitance tolerance of +/-5%, which provides a balance between precision and flexibility. This tolerance level is suitable for a vast array of electrical circuits, ensuring that the capacitor will function as expected within a system without causing significant deviations from the desired performance.

The use of polypropylene as the dielectric material in the Metallizing Film Capacitor is a decisive factor in its high performance. Polypropylene offers excellent electrical characteristics, such as low dielectric absorption and high dielectric strength, which contribute to the capacitor's reliability and longevity. Moreover, the metallization process further enhances these properties, leading to a component that not only meets but exceeds the stringent demands of modern electronic systems.

One of the primary application occasions for the CL Metallized Polypropylene Capacitor is within power supply units. These capacitors are employed to improve power factor, reduce harmonic distortion, and provide voltage stabilization in both linear and switch-mode power supplies. The high-rated voltage and stable capacitance make this capacitor suitable for smoothing and filtering applications, ensuring a steady and reliable power supply to critical components.

In the automotive industry, these metalized film capacitors are integral to the performance and reliability of electronic control units, infotainment systems, and powertrain components. The robustness of the CL brand capacitors, combined with their ability to withstand temperature variations and electrical disturbances, makes them an ideal choice for automotive applications where reliability is paramount.

The industrial sector also benefits greatly from the use of CL Metallized Polypropylene Film Capacitors. Their application extends to motor run and motor start circuits, lighting ballasts, and energy storage in renewable energy systems. The capacitors’ high precision and stability contribute to the efficient operation of heavy-duty industrial machinery and equipment, minimizing downtime and maintenance costs.

Q3: What are the typical applications for CL Metallized Polypropylene Film Capacitors?

A3: CL Metallized Polypropylene Film Capacitors are commonly used in AC power applications, such as motor run, power factor correction, and lighting circuits, as well as in high-frequency and DC circuits for snubber, coupling, and decoupling purposes.

Q4: Can CL Metallized Polypropylene Film Capacitors be used in high-temperature environments?

A4: While CL Metallized Polypropylene Film Capacitors are designed to withstand certain temperature ranges, it's important to refer to the specific product datasheet for the maximum operating temperature to ensure the capacitor meets the requirements of your application.

Q5: Are CL Metallized Polypropylene Film Capacitors suitable for audio applications?

A5: Yes, CL Metallized Polypropylene Film Capacitors are often used in audio applications due to their low dielectric absorption and low ESR (Equivalent Series Resistance), which contribute to high-quality sound performance.
